![]() I know I'm in the huge minority on this. But I hate that they're switching back. No, they shouldn't have switched in the first place, but unlike SA they had no major drainage or other issues, right?
My main reason for being opposed to the move is I usually do really well anytime one meet ends and another meet starts and they switch surfaces. You can usually nail long shots early in meets that can't run on one surface, but wake up on the other. I mean like when Arlington goes to Hawthrone When SA goes to Hollywood (and now Del Mar) Keeneland to Churchill to Turfway Golden Gate to the fair tracks with dirt. So my reasons are purely for handicapping, but that's why I want Del Mar to stay synthetic. The one outcome that I hope comes from this, that in the future when SoCal horses can't hack it on dirt, maybe a lot more will ship to GG to try and get some success from that surface? ****, I'd even love the Aqueduct inner to go synthetic lol For you guys naming all these synth winners, is it really any different for a horse that can't run a step on dirt, but thrives on turf?
